Fine motor skills are crucial for children aged 7-9 as they significantly impact their reading abilities. During this developmental stage, children are not only refining their hand-eye coordination but also enhancing skills fundamental to writing and manipulating reading tools like books and pencils. Engaging in activities that promote fine motor skills—such as cutting, drawing, or using manipulatives—supports their ability to grip and maneuver writing implements, leading to improved handwriting and note-taking, both vital for academic success.
Moreover, fine motor development is closely linked to cognitive functions. As children become more adept in their manual dexterity, they are better equipped to focus on the reading process itself. They can comfortably hold books, flip through pages, and track words without physical interference. This allows them to devote their cognitive resources toward comprehension and storytelling.
For teachers and parents, fostering fine motor skills means creating a foundation for a positive reading experience, which in turn cultivates a love for literature. Promoting fine motor activities at home and in the classroom transforms the learning environment into one that encourages creativity, confidence, and autonomy—essential components in becoming proficient and enthusiastic readers. Hence, attention to fine motor skills during these formative years is indispensable.
